Stunning traverse of the Kinder Scout plateau, including the famous Downfall.
From the village hall, walk up Kinder Road to the Snake Path and follow it to Twenty Trees and the white Shooting Cabin. Then bear right towards Edale and contour high above the reservoir with great views of Kinder. Descend the steep path down to the small footbridge at the bottom and then ascend William Clough. Continue upwards to Ashop Head where the Pennine Way joins the path and turn right. Carry on along the edge path to Sandy Heys and onto the impressive Kinder Downfall, waterfall. Continue along the Pennine Way to Kinder Low trig point, rising to 2,000ft (636m).
Continue to the flag path, following the route to the left, to Edale Road. Turn right through the gate and away from the Pennine Way. The route is then downhill towards Hayfield. Leave the moorland and walk on a path through fields to the tarmac road at Coldwell Clough. Carry on, keeping the stream on your left. Re-join the metalled road at Ashes Farm and continue to Bowden Bridge car park. Here turn left, and walk first alongside the campsite, then on the riverside path 1 mile back to the village.
Approximate length of walk: 10 miles
Grade of walk: hard. Much of the route is on rough moorland paths
